-- ============================================
-- 修复消耗单主表(lq_xh_hyhk)F_OvertimeSgfy 和 sgfy 历史数据
-- ============================================
-- 背景:主表加班手工费已改为「健康师原始手工费之和 × 加班系数」,科技部不参与加班。
-- 本脚本修复历史数据,使 F_OvertimeSgfy 和 sgfy 符合新逻辑。
--
-- 修复逻辑:
-- F_OvertimeSgfy = 健康师原始手工费之和 × F_OvertimeCoefficient
-- sgfy = F_OriginalSgfy + F_OvertimeSgfy
--
-- 健康师原始手工费:优先用 F_OriginalLaborCost,为空时用 F_LaborCost - F_OvertimeLaborCost
-- F_OriginalSgfy 为空时:用 健康师原始之和 + 科技部原始之和 补全
--
-- 执行前请先备份!建议在测试环境验证后再在生产环境执行。
-- ============================================
-- 1. 预览:查看需要修复的记录(只读,可先执行验证)
-- ============================================
/*
SELECT
h.F_Id,
h.F_OriginalSgfy AS 当前原始手工费,
h.F_OvertimeSgfy AS 当前加班手工费,
h.sgfy AS 当前最终手工费,
h.F_OvertimeCoefficient AS 加班系数,
COALESCE(j.jks_sum, 0) AS 健康师原始手工费之和,
COALESCE(j.jks_sum, 0) * COALESCE(h.F_OvertimeCoefficient, 0) AS 新加班手工费,
COALESCE(h.F_OriginalSgfy, COALESCE(j.jks_sum, 0) + COALESCE(k.kjb_sum, 0)) + (COALESCE(j.jks_sum, 0) * COALESCE(h.F_OvertimeCoefficient, 0)) AS 新最终手工费
FROM lq_xh_hyhk h
LEFT JOIN (
SELECT glkdbh,
SUM(COALESCE(F_OriginalLaborCost, GREATEST(0, COALESCE(F_LaborCost, 0) - COALESCE(F_OvertimeLaborCost, 0)))) AS jks_sum
FROM lq_xh_jksyj
WHERE F_IsEffective = 1
GROUP BY glkdbh
) j ON h.F_Id = j.glkdbh
LEFT JOIN (
SELECT glkdbh,
SUM(COALESCE(F_OriginalLaborCost, F_LaborCost)) AS kjb_sum
FROM lq_xh_kjbsyj
WHERE F_IsEffective = 1
GROUP BY glkdbh
) k ON h.F_Id = k.glkdbh
WHERE h.F_IsEffective = 1
AND (
COALESCE(h.F_OvertimeSgfy, 0) != COALESCE(j.jks_sum, 0) * COALESCE(h.F_OvertimeCoefficient, 0)
OR COALESCE(h.sgfy, 0) != COALESCE(h.F_OriginalSgfy, COALESCE(j.jks_sum, 0) + COALESCE(k.kjb_sum, 0)) + (COALESCE(j.jks_sum, 0) * COALESCE(h.F_OvertimeCoefficient, 0))
)
LIMIT 50;
*/
-- ============================================
-- 2. 执行修复:更新 F_OvertimeSgfy 和 sgfy
-- ============================================
UPDATE lq_xh_hyhk h
INNER JOIN (
SELECT glkdbh,
SUM(COALESCE(F_OriginalLaborCost, GREATEST(0, COALESCE(F_LaborCost, 0) - COALESCE(F_OvertimeLaborCost, 0)))) AS jks_sum
FROM lq_xh_jksyj
WHERE F_IsEffective = 1
GROUP BY glkdbh
) j ON h.F_Id = j.glkdbh
LEFT JOIN (
SELECT glkdbh,
SUM(COALESCE(F_OriginalLaborCost, F_LaborCost)) AS kjb_sum
FROM lq_xh_kjbsyj
WHERE F_IsEffective = 1
GROUP BY glkdbh
) k ON h.F_Id = k.glkdbh
SET
h.F_OvertimeSgfy = COALESCE(j.jks_sum, 0) * COALESCE(h.F_OvertimeCoefficient, 0),
h.sgfy = COALESCE(h.F_OriginalSgfy, COALESCE(j.jks_sum, 0) + COALESCE(k.kjb_sum, 0)) + (COALESCE(j.jks_sum, 0) * COALESCE(h.F_OvertimeCoefficient, 0))
WHERE h.F_IsEffective = 1;
-- 说明:上述 UPDATE 使用 INNER JOIN j,因此仅更新「存在健康师业绩」的耗卡记录。
-- 若耗卡仅有科技部、无健康师,则 j 子查询无结果,该记录不会被更新。
-- 对于「仅科技部」的耗卡,正确逻辑应为:F_OvertimeSgfy=0,sgfy=F_OriginalSgfy,需单独处理。
-- ============================================
-- 3. 补充修复:仅科技部、无健康师的耗卡(F_OvertimeSgfy 应为 0,sgfy = 原始手工费)
-- ============================================
UPDATE lq_xh_hyhk h
LEFT JOIN (
SELECT glkdbh
FROM lq_xh_jksyj
WHERE F_IsEffective = 1
GROUP BY glkdbh
) j ON h.F_Id = j.glkdbh
LEFT JOIN (
SELECT glkdbh,
SUM(COALESCE(F_OriginalLaborCost, F_LaborCost)) AS kjb_sum
FROM lq_xh_kjbsyj
WHERE F_IsEffective = 1
GROUP BY glkdbh
) k ON h.F_Id = k.glkdbh
SET
h.F_OvertimeSgfy = 0,
h.sgfy = COALESCE(h.F_OriginalSgfy, COALESCE(k.kjb_sum, 0), h.sgfy)
WHERE h.F_IsEffective = 1
AND j.glkdbh IS NULL
AND (COALESCE(h.F_OvertimeSgfy, 0) != 0);
